  • The job holder will follow-up SAPL Contractor activities and will ensure theSAPL is engineered, fabricated, integrated, delivered and tested in due time, ready for installation as per project planning.
  • The job holders must possessstrong experience designing offshore subsea production systems to ensure itssafe and optimum project delivery as well asreliable operation.
  • Performing all duties in line with Company procedures.
  • Ensurehigh quality of all deliverables fromConcept, Basic Engineering, Detailed Engineering / Qualification / Manufacturing / Fabrication / Construction / Installation / Pre-Commissioning activities performed by Contractor, whilst respectinglocal content requirement.
  • Identify and solve technical issues relating to theAutomated Subsea Pig Launcher (ASPL) package that may arise during all activities of the Project.
  • Ensure theprompt and efficient dispatch, review and approval of allDetailed Engineering / Qualification / Manufacturing / Fabrication / Construction / Installation / Pre-Commissioning documents issued byAutomated Subsea Pig Launcher Contractor, in due time, ensuring the adequate level of priority is given.
  • Able to lead the designing and developing of the ASPL system in compliance withindustry standards and client requirements.
  • Able toreview calculations, simulations, and analyses to ensure theintegrity and reliability of subsea equipment.
  • Collaborating with multidisciplinary teams to optimisesubsea system delivery, installation and operational performance.
  • Conducting risk assessments and implementing mitigation measures.
  • Responsible for the technical coordination of discipline work-scopes that cover thefunction and design of all parts of the ASPL system.
  • Apply a system level view and decision making to the following typical activities:
    • PFDs, schematics, block diagrams, field layout.
    • Production assurance / flow assurance.
    • Reliability / availability modelling.
    • Inspection, maintenance, monitoring and repair considering the routine interventions that will be required tore-load the pig launcher.
    • Testing and commissioning philosophies.
    • Material selection, coatings and CP.
    • Process safety, protection and risk management.
  • Identify, evaluate and manage the key system technical risks, seeking mitigations where possible and populating therisk registers, ensuringcritical, high consequence risk items are escalated.
  • Liaise with Project QHSES, QAQC, to ensure that theASPL scope is designed to be safe, operable, and maintainable.
  • Assist QA/QC Manager for allquality issues related to ASPL engineering.
  • Monitor Contractor performance againstengineering aspects of the Contract and assist theOffshore Package Manager / PCM in management of associatedChange Order Requests.
  • Initiate and attend all ASPL engineering meetings, routine and subject specific, to pursueContractor's resolution and close-out of documents.
  • Ensure that agreed project battery limits are adhered to.

  • Minimum Education: Engineer / Master Civil Engineering degree or other relevant and recognized qualification, have aSystems Engineering or Engineering Management background, includingdetailed knowledge of subsea systems and aminimum of 15yrs+ experience of working in subsea projects andproven experience in major oil and gas projects, in Offshore large projects.
  • Proven Major Oil and Gas project developments knowledge and experience.
  • Prior experience in Design Leadership / Project Management.
  • 15+ years’ experience in one or more of the following packages:
    • Subsea Engineering.
    • Project Engineering.
    • Hardware package delivery (Systems, Trees, Controls, Pipelines, Manifolds etc.).
  • Installation experience.
  • Experience with subsea structure design and subsea operational pigging.
  • In-depth knowledge of subsea engineering and the relevant best practices, codes & standards.
  • Familiar with Marine Operations using Remotely Operated Vehicle (ROV).
  • Past experience in Caspian Sea is a plus.
  • Total Energies experience is an added advantage.

Language Requirements:

  • Fluent English mandatory.
  • Azerbaijani language skills will assist performance.

 

Location:Position based in Baku, withfrequent missions as requested at SAPL Contractor locations (UK or Norway).
